About Curtin Singapore

Curtin university Singapore established in 2008 and is the official Singapore campus of Curtin University Australia. Students who graduate from Curtin Singapore will get the same global recognition as graduated from Curtin Australia.

In 2010, Curtin Singapore is one of the 1st batch institutions received the Singapore Education Trust Certification awards, and obtain it again and maintain its status until today. This award is given to PEIs for sustaining an excellent level of performance in managing their institutions and providing high-quality education standards and welfare for their students.

Managed by Specialists – Navitas

Curtin Singapore is managed and operated by Curtin Education Centre, part of Navitas Pty Limited.

Navitas is a global educational group that enhances the Curtin Singapore educational experience with its extensive experience in providing quality services to students. The specialist management skills at Navitas complement our longstanding national and international reputation for the delivery of quality education.

Accommodation (Hostel Options)

Most of the foreign universities in Singapore does not have on-campus accommodation as well as Curtin Singapore. University has alliances with a group of reputed local private accommodation service providers for international students.

Depending on the location, the number of people per room and room facilities, the accommodation fees are from S$330 to S$1,660 per month. Some of the prime location with good room facility fees are over S$2,000.

Cross Campus Transfer and Exchange

Curtin Singapore provides opportunities for students to transfer and exchange to other Curtin campuses. Students can transfer their studies to other Curtin campuses such as Perth, Kalgoorlie, Malaysia, Singapore, Dubai and Mauritius. They also can do campus exchange for 1 semester at Curtin Perth campus

What Curtin Singapore Graduate Placements / Employment Rate?

Singapore Committee for Private Education (CPE) released its annual private education institution (PEI) Graduate Employment Survey 2017/18 results on 10 April 2019.
According to that overall employment rate for Curtin Education Centre (Curtin Singapore) in 2017/18 was 78% with medium gross monthly salary of S$3,000.
This is slightly higher than the 2016/17 medium gross monthly salary of S$2,800.

What are the entry requirements for Curtin Singapore?

Diploma: min. IELTS 5.5 (no component lower than 5.0) or equivalent. A secondary education qualification equivalent to Australia Year 11 with 50% average
 
Undergraduate: min. IELTS 6.0 (no component lower than 6.0) or equivalent. 12 years of schooling or equivalent, the result differ from country to country
 
Postgraduate: min. IELTS 6.5 (no component lower than 6.0) or equivalent. A bachelor degree in any discipline from a recognised university.
